Membranes and Waterbars Technology Characteristics Applications References Innovations Technology Sika's product technology membranes and waterbars is used against rainwater for buildings and against leakage water in civil engineering. This technology offers a wide spectrum of special sealing solutions for technical applications, such as swimming pools, ponds, liquid-manure cisterns, drinking water reservoirs, oil and gasoline tanks, etc. Since the material must be, primarily, compatible with hot-air welding, only thermoplastic plastics can be used. With respect to long life and durability, we mainly use plastified PVC and polyolefins (polyethylene PE, polypropylene PP and ethylene vinyl acetate copolymer EVA as well as alloys). In manufacturing our plastic waterproofing sheets, we use the processes of calendering and extrusion/coextrusion. The first step of either process involves the homogenization of the ingredients into a plastic mass. This is achieved by means of a hot or cool mixer, followed by kneading through a BUSS kneader or a planetary roller extruder. Or the mass may also be precompounded. The pieces are then molded in the 2nd step by means of a calender bowl (calendering) or a sheet die (extrusion). top
Characteristics Different characteristics and requirements are necessary for different applications. In general, when developing roofing sheets, we pay special attention to the following: - Easy hot-air welding, broader welding windows and no effects on welding behavior as a result of UV radiation and heat during installation.
- Reliable mechanical properties in the temperature range from -40°C to +70°C. The same is true of cold-temperature stability, cold-folding, perforation, resistance to tearing and elongation at tear.
- The sheets are characterized by good weathering resistance, both in terms of exposure to artificial and natural atmospheric conditions, which ensures the longevity of these sheets.
- High degree of flexibility, i.e., low elastic modulus.
- Low vapor resistance. The roof membrane must be able to "breathe".
- High degree of fireproofing against flying sparks and radiating heat.

Applications Building construction: Whenever flat roofs, low-pitched roofs, special designs, roof gardens or utility roofs need to be constructed, renovated or rehabilitated, our range of roofing sheets will prove to be a convincing solution - and best of all, architects or designers will not be restricted in their creativity. Sika-Trocal offers the following systems: Civil engineering: We develop plastic waterproofing sheets to be used in tunnel construction (both for drift and strip mining), which help prevent the infiltration of leakage and groundwater, which can be quite aggressive at times. This application requires such sheeting to have a long life of up to 100 years - a tremendous challenge in terms of the material. Technical membranes: Using brand names such as "Trocal" or "Mipoplast", Sika-Trocal offers a series of technical membranes, which can be adapted and customized accurately for individ-ual uses. The range of possible uses includes membranes for ponds, sheeting for swimming pools, applications in construction, drinking-water reservoirs, liquid-manure cisterns and lining for gasoline or oil tanks. top

Innovations Our innovations of the past few years include: - The development and marketing of the polyolefin-based roofing sheet "Futura".
- The development and marketing of the polyolefin-based sheeting "PECO" used in tunnels for drift and strip mining - highly praised by our customers for its flexibility and weldability.
- The development and marketing of a membrane used for lining drinking water reservoirs, based on a pure polyolefin alloy, which stands out for its excellent welding properties and meets the strict drinking water standards of Germany: the KTW recommendations for application of plastics in drinking water pipes and the DVGW W270 Recommended Practice (German Association of Gas and Water).
- The development and marketing of a TPU-based membrane used as lining for gasoline tanks.
